A mortgage creditor violated the automatic stay by mistakenly filing a claim to which it had no rights and by failing to immediately return payments on that claim it had received by the trustee. In re Mocella, No. 10-42287 (Bankr. N.D. Ohio June 15, 2016)…Incompetence Does Not Excuse Stay Violation

The CFPB outlines four principles to guide its discussions on the future of loss mitigation as the U.S. Treasury’s crisis-era Home Affordable Modification Program is phased out at the end of 2016…CFPB Issues Principles for Future of Loss Mitigation
